What to expect

Expect very chill, folk/singer-songwriter vibes from my music, playing in the background or forefront of your event, for any duration up to 3 hours. With my acoustic guitar, I'll sing and play a mix of covers and originals, plenty of classics and some unique tunes -- a setlist I'm happy to tailor to your preferences. You can expect a steady volume level throughout my performance, and a quick 30min load in and load out time.

About

Anna Hudson is tired of trying to fit in. She knows what it’s like to feel out of place, stuck, or pulled in multiple directions at once. But songwriting has always been her bridge between chaos and peace. Raised in the small town of Winston-Salem, NC, Hudson draws inspiration from the vast array of American musical influences, and describes her sound as “Bon Iver if he were a 22-year-old girl.”

Her debut EP, Kyphosis, perfectly demonstrates the purpose and meaning of music in her mind: exploring both the natural and unnatural curves of life, friendship, and love while growing up.

Anna is a veteran gigging musician, having played regularly at restaurants and small local venues in the Winston-Salem, NC and Boston areas since 2019.
